Crafting Your Manuscript
1. Engaging Title
Your title should be catchy yet informative. It should give readers a glimpse into what your manuscript is about while also being specific enough to pique their interest.
2. Abstract and Keywords
The abstract is your manuscript's elevator pitch. It should succinctly summarize your research question, methodology, results, and conclusions. Include relevant keywords to improve SEO.
3. Methodology
Detail your research methodology thoroughly. Explain how you conducted your study, including any tools or software used. This transparency builds credibility.
